Temperature Stability Minimum [°C] | Temperature Stability Maximum [°C] | Comment | Organism |
---|---|---|---|
additional information | - |
trehalose stabilizes both isozymes at 60°C and 70°C and increases the enzyme activity, thermal deactivation kinetics of enzyme forms XylI and XylII | Bacillus subtilis |
60 | - |
50% final residual activity in presence of 0.5 M trehalose as well as 8fold increased half-life of XylII and 2.5fold of XylI, inactivation in absence of trehalose | Bacillus subtilis |
70 | - |
35% final residual activity in presence of 0.5 M trehalose as well as 2fold increased half-lives of XylII and XylI, inactivation in absence of trehalose | Bacillus subtilis |
